Birlasoft

Technical Specialist-App Development

Birlasoft  •  Hyderabad, IN (Onsite)  •  1 month ago
Apply
AI can make mistakes so check important info. Chat history is never stored.

Job Description

Area(s) of responsibility

Job Title: .NET Developer (Web API / Web Services – XML Processing & Security)

We are seeking a skilled .NET Developer to design and build secure, scalable Web APIs / Web Services that can receive XML-based request packets from external applications and persist the data to the server file system. The ideal candidate will have strong experience in backend development using .NET, XML processing, API security, and collaboration within Agile teams.

Key Responsibilities:

  • Design and develop RESTful Web APIs / SOAP Web Services using .NET (C#)
  • Build secure endpoints to receive XML request payloads from external systems
  • Implement authentication and authorization mechanisms for API consumers
  • Parse, validate, and process incoming XML data
  • Store XML/data files securely on the server file system
  • Ensure proper error handling, logging, and monitoring
  • Implement API security measures (rate limiting, input validation, etc.)
  • Write clear JIRA user stories, tasks, and technical documentation
  • Collaborate with QA team and support testing activities (SIT/UAT)
  • Work closely with cross-functional teams and external stakeholders
  • Troubleshoot and support production issues

Required Skills & Qualifications:

  • Strong experience with C#, ASP.NET, .NET Core / .NET 6+
  • Hands-on experience building secure Web APIs or SOAP services
  • Experience implementing API authentication & authorization (OAuth 2.0, JWT, API Keys)
  • Proficiency in XML parsing (XDocument, XmlReader, serialization/deserialization)
  • Experience with file handling and I/O operations in .NET
  • Strong understanding of HTTP protocols, REST standards, and API security
  • Experience with version control tools like Bitbucket (Git-based workflows)
  • Hands-on experience working with JIRA for story writing and tracking
  • Experience supporting QA/testing teams during SIT/UAT phases

Preferred Qualifications:

  • Experience with API gateways (Azure API Management, Kong)
  • Knowledge of identity providers (Azure AD, Auth0, Okta)
  • Exposure to cloud platforms (Azure/AWS)
  • Experience with CI/CD pipelines and DevOps practices

Good to Have:

  • Experience handling large XML payloads / batch processing
  • Knowledge of XSD validation
  • Familiarity with microservices architecture
  • Understanding of data encryption (at rest and in transit)

Key Competencies:

  • Strong problem-solving and analytical skills
  • Attention to detail and security best practices
  • Good communication and documentation skills
  • Ability to work in a collaborative Agile environment
  • Flexibility to support global teams

Work Requirements:

  • Willingness to work in US client time zones / shifts
  • Ability to coordinate with distributed teams and stakeholders

Experience Level:

4–6 years

Birlasoft

About Birlasoft

Navigating Change. Powering Progress. | Reimagining the Future with Birlasoft

Birlasoft, a powerhouse where domain expertise, enterprise solutions, and digital technologies converge to redefine business processes. We take pride in our consultative and design thinking approach, driving societal progress by enabling our customers to run businesses with unmatched efficiency and innovation. As part of the CKA Birla Group, a multibillion-dollar enterprise, we boast a 12,000+ professional team committed to upholding the Group's 170-year legacy. Our core values prioritize Diversity, Equity, and Inclusion (DEI) initiatives, along with Corporate Social Responsibility (CSR) activities, demonstrating our dedication to building inclusive and sustainable communities. Join us in shaping a future where technology seamlessly aligns with purpose.

For further information, visit www.birlasoft.com

Industry
IT & Software
Company Size
10,000+ employees
Headquarters
Pune, IN
Year Founded
Unknown
Social Media